Twin brothers, Billy and Bobby, kid mother grandparents lawn together for 60 minutes. Billy could mow the lawn by himself in 20

minutes less time then it would take Bobby. How long will it take Bobby to mow the lawn by himself
Mathematics
1 answer:
Dovator [93]3 years ago
3 0

Answer:

Bobby around 131 minutes and Billy around 111 minutes

Step-by-step explanation:

To solve the problem it is important to raise equations regarding what happens.

 They tell us that Billy (Bi) and Bobby (Bo) can mow the lawn in 60 minutes. That is to say that what they prune in a minute is giving as follows:

1 / Bo + 1 / Bi = 1/60 (1)

They say Billy could mow the lawn only in 20 minutes less than it would take Bobby, therefore

1 / Bi = 1 / (Bo-20) (2)

Replacing (2) in (1) we have:

1 / Bo + 1 / (Bo-20) = 1/60

Resolving

(Bo - 20 + B0) / (Bo * (Bo-20) = 1/60

120 * Bo - 1200 = Bo ^ 2 - 20Bo

Rearranging:

Bo ^ 2 - 140Bo -1200 = 0

Now applying the general equation

Bo = 130.82 or Bo = 9.17, <em>this last value cannot be because Billy took 20 minutes less and neither can he prune faster than the two together</em>, therefore Bobby only takes around 131 minutes and Billy around 111 minutes

Checking with equation 1:

1/131 +1/111 = ~ 1/60

<h3>What is compound interest?</h3>

The amount of money earned, in compound interest, after t years, is given by:

A(t) = P\left(1 + \frac{r}{n}\right)^{nt}

In which:

  • A(t) is the amount of money after t years.
  • P is the principal(the initial sum of money).
  • r is the interest rate(as a decimal value).
  • n is the number of times that interest is compounded per year.

The <u>interest rate per compounding period</u> is given as follows:

\left(1 + \frac{r}{n}\right)^n - 1
